Main Benefits of Tire Balers
Tyre balers play a key role in the recycling process by compressing discarded tires into convenient bales. This not only makes shipping more efficient but also maximizes storage efficiency. By reducing the volume of tires, businesses can save on holding expenses and make supply chain management more effective, enabling a more rapid turnaround in the processing cycle. The compact bundles are easier to handle and can be stored more efficiently in a processing facility.
Another notable benefit of tire balers is their contribution to green sustainability. By making sure that tires are baled and repurposed efficiently, these devices help to redirect waste from landfills, where tires can take a long time to break down. Instead of contributing to waste and ecological degradation, repurposed tyres can be repurposed into numerous items, such as rubber mulch, asphalt, and even new tyres. This transformation aligns with international efforts to promote a circular economy.
